Sustainable development covers environmental, social, and economic dimensions and requires a multi-disciplinary approach in order to examine, explore, and critically engage with issues and advances in these and related areas. Strategies, methods, and technologies for mitigating, preparing, responding, and recovering from various kinds of disasters (including natural and technological/man made) are needed in order to achieve the goal of sustainability and sustainable development and at the same time enhance our disaster management practices.
